Question #55574
The rate constant for this zero-order reaction is 0.0380 M·s–1 at 300 °C.
A --> Products
How long (in seconds) would it take for the concentration of A to decrease from 0.920 M to 0.340 M?

Zero order reaction equation:
[A] = [A]0 – kt;
[A]0 – [A] = kt;
t = ([A]0 – [A])/k = (0.920 M – 0.340 M)/(0.0380 M s-1) = 15.3 s
Answer: 15.3 s
